> I think the Times is interpreting the odds incorrectly. The way to
> read the odds is 1/5 means for every $5 wagered, you would get only
> $1. That means, in the below case chances of ARR winning are seen to
> be far higher - meaning if you wagered $35 you only get $1 if ARR won.
>
> I reproduce this example from a forum:
>
> As an example. How do Winslet and Streep stack up against each other?
>
> Kate Winslet 1/3
> Meryl Streep 4/1
>
> Think of it as, "If you want to win the amount of money on the left,
> you have to bet the amount of money on the right." So if we're talking
> dollars, a $3 bet for Kate Winslet would pay off in $1 won. However,
> betting only $1 on Meryl Streep would pay off in $4 won (and a $3 bet
> on her would give you $12). Thus, they're saying Kate is 12 times more
> likely to win.
